Dance Consortium and Como No Add Barbican Hall, London Date to Danza Contemporánea de Cuba UK Tour 2017
Presented by Dance Consortium and Como No in London, the additional Barbican Hall performance will mark Danza Contemporánea de Cuba's Barbican debut.
A stunning blend of Afro Caribbean rhythms, jazzy American modernism and inflections from European ballet, Danza Contemporánea de Cuba's hybrid, hothouse style has been evoking the sensual heart of Cuban spirit for over 50 years.
This electrifying new show sees the company team up with three leading and highly sought after choreographers: Sky Arts Award and National Dance Award winner Annabelle Lopez Ochoa; the UK's Theo Clinkard; and the Company's very own Cuban wunderkind George Céspedes.
Repertoire:
Reversible / Annabelle Lopez Ochoa
The Listening Room / Theo Clinkard
Matria Etnocentra / George Cespedes
